The map separates locations known as LSOAs (Lower-layer Super Output Areas) which are small areas designed to be of a similar population size, with an average of approximately 1,500 residents or 650 households. Its said to be the largest non-industrial conurbation in Europe and is the largest urban area in the UK that doesnt contain anywhere with city status.
